  • proper noun A taxonomic genus within the family Psittacidae — the hanging parrots.

  • Three are endemic and threatened, including the endangered Flores monarch (Monarcha sacerdotum) and the vulnerable Wallace's hanging-parrot (Loriculus flosculus) and Flores crow (Corvus florensis).

    Lesser Sundas deciduous forests 2008

  • One species found on Sangihe, the cerulean paradise flycatcher (Eutrichomyias rowleyi), is critically endangered, and the red-and-blue lory (Eos histro), Sangihe hanging-parrot (Loriculus catamene), and elegant sunbird (Aethopyga duyvenbodei), all found on Sangihe and Talaud, are endangered.

    Sulawesi lowland rain forests 2007
